Is it OK to withdraw cash from credit card?

Is it okay to withdraw cash using a credit card? While it is okay to withdraw cash using a credit card, it is advised not to do so as it involves multiple additional charges, which makes such transactions quite expensive.

How much money can you withdraw from an ATM with a credit card?

Lastly, credit card cash withdrawals are almost always limited to a set amount, called the cash credit limit — usually around $300 to $500.

What is the best way to get cash from a credit card?

Withdraw money from an ATM where your credit card is accepted. Select “credit” when prompted to make a withdrawal from checking, savings or credit. Go to a bank to withdraw money against the limit on your credit card. Check that the bank offers advances from your credit card issuer, such as Mastercard or Visa.

How can I withdraw money from my credit card without PIN number?

The easiest way to withdraw cash from a credit card without a PIN is to visit a bank that does business with your credit card company, ask the teller for a cash advance, and present your card along with a government-issued photo ID.

Can I get cash out of the ATM with my credit card?

You may be asking yourself “Can I get cash out of the ATM with my credit card?” Yes! Most credit cards will let you withdraw cash at an ATM. Great news, right? No way! Borrowing money on your credit card is a cash advance, a type of short-term loan, and it’s worlds away from a simple debit card cash withdrawal.

Is it bad to get a cash advance from an ATM?

Cash advances usually come with very high fees. Even worse, cash advances can signal to lenders that you’re being irresponsible with money during a credit check. It’s probably in your best interest to avoid using anything but your debit card with an ATM.

What are credit card withdrawals and how do they work?

They essentially act as a short-term loan and can be accessed by withdrawing cash at an ATM with your credit card’s PIN number, by requesting one in-person at your bank or by writing a convenience check (if your card provides them) to yourself and then cashing or depositing it.
